With the rising value of AI/ML spanning training and inference models and data, as well as the AI hardware itself, the threats from adversaries are greater than ever. As such, a security strategy for AI/ML workloads and hardware needs to offer far more than secure boot and authentication. Rambus security expert, Bart Stevens will discuss how a hardware root of trust can be the foundation for AI/ML security through defense in depth, partitioning of secure operations, and state-of-the-art protections from side channel attacks.

Bart Stevens is senior director of product management for Rambus Security. He is an expert on embedded security for Enterprise, Cloud, Automotive, Networking, Wireless, IoT and Mobile applications. Before joining Rambus, Bart held positions at Inside Secure as Vice President of silicon IP and secure communication, and as Director of product management, with responsibility for security chip and silicon IP products. Prior to those roles, Bart managed SafeNet’s OEM networking and wireless HW research and development teams. He has also held product and engineering management roles at Securealink and Philips Semiconductors in the Netherlands. He began his career as an ASIC designer.
